Massachusetts Senate To Vote Thursday on Conversion Therapy Ban

The Massachusetts Senate plans to vote Thursday on a bill that would ban conversion therapy for minors.

Senate President Karen Spilka (D-Ashland) said the bill was voted out of committee Monday, March 25 and will go to the Senate floor Thursday, March 28, according to video of a press conference published by State House News Service.

Harvard Undergraduate House Purges Portrait of Namesake

An undergraduate dormitory at Harvard College will not display a portrait of the man it's mostly named for when it re-opens in the fall of 2019.

The portrait of Abbott Lawrence Lowell (1856-1943) and his wife Anna has hung for years in the dining hall of Lowell House, one of 12 undergraduate houses at Harvard College where sophomores, juniors, and seniors live.
